Output e5c7f4037975a1cbe4efa4aa8ee5ae476a8610231a0b0972d5f22465a89be628:21

value
643779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a00514431d8724645df66b0f957d168bcc1fa7 OP_EQUAL
address
3CgphwHmSPAw4QJvxY9GhiP8FTsNKsdiu3
transaction
e5c7f4037975a1cbe4efa4aa8ee5ae476a8610231a0b0972d5f22465a89be628
spent
true